The Diabetes Code: Prevent and Reverse Type 2 Diabetes Naturally
Dr. Jason Fung presents a provocative, evidence-based approach that argues type 2 diabetes can improve or even reverse with dietary strategy and intermittent fasting. The book explains how reducing carbohydrate intake and improving insulin sensitivity can disrupt the disease’s progression, alongside practical guidance for implementing meal timing and lifestyle changes. It’s written in a clear, persuasive voice designed to empower readers to take control of their health through achievable, testable steps rather than dependency on medication alone.
